Letter: U.S. produces second-stringers

By Kim Worth, VANCOUVER
Published: August 30, 2016, 6:00am

I felt columnist Leonard Pitts’ pain when reading his Aug. 22 column “Maintaining perpetual Trump outrage is exhausting.” And I can help by offering one word (in brackets) to add to the second sentence: “I am tired of (trashing) Donald Trump.”

Of course he is. The Donald is a self-stuffing pinata. Every morning, no matter the bashing he just received, there he is again, rejuvenated, stuffed until the seams are straining, ready to be whacked, to spill crazy all over the landscape. How can you resist?

If Pitts could just take a deep breath, and look a couple of feet beyond this easy target, what do we see?

Why it’s the Hillary pi?ata! Just as juicy and tempting. Stuffed with illegal, self-serving emails, “experience” which is actually a string of failures (Honduras, Ukraine, Libya, Syria, HillaryCare, ’03 Iraq vote — did I miss anything?), lies, health issues and, being Hillary Clinton, more lies.

What an opportunity to step away from the ongoing exposition of clueless irrelevance that Pitts and the establishment liberal commentators exhibit with their desperate “sheep-dogging” for Clinton and start to address the real issue: how did America, at this point of crisis, elevate these two second-stringers to be our presidential contenders? Does America just not produce Jeffersons and Lincolns anymore?
